This script converts a Pascal voc file to a text file in YOLO format. For Japanese → https://qiita.com/Rihib/items/e163d90c009f4fe12782
Example 1:
>>python main.py --help
usage: main.py [-h] [--absolutepath_of_directory_with_xmlfiles XML]
[--absolutepath_of_directory_with_imgfiles IMG]
[--absolutepath_of_directory_with_yolofiles YOLO]
[--absolutepath_of_directory_with_classes_txt CLS]
[--absolutepath_of_directory_with_error_txt ERR]
Create YOLO annotations from Pascal VOC
optional arguments:
-h, --help show this help message and exit
--absolutepath_of_directory_with_xmlfiles XML, -xml XML
Path of xml files, It is okay to have a mix of xml
files and images in the same directory.
--absolutepath_of_directory_with_imgfiles IMG, -img IMG
Path of image files
--absolutepath_of_directory_with_yolofiles YOLO, -yol YOLO
Yolo annotation files will be created under this
directory
--absolutepath_of_directory_with_classes_txt CLS, -cls CLS
You do not need to create classes.txt. classes.txt
will be generated automatically in this path
--absolutepath_of_directory_with_error_txt ERR, -err ERR
The names of files that do not have a paired xml or
image file will be written to a text file under this
directory
Example 2:
>>python main.py -xml=filter_annotations -img=filter_images -yol=dataset/yolo -cls=dataset -err=dataset
